The metal rhodium has a FCC crystal structure. If the angle of diffraction for the (311) set of planes occurs at 36.12° (first order reflection) when monochromatic x-radiation having a wavelength of 0.0711nm is used, compute (a) the interplanar spacing for the set of planes and (b) the atomic radius for the rhodium atom.
